New York | N.Y. Veh. & Traf. Law § 1196 | Alcohol and Drug Rehabilitation Program |
The commissioner shall establish a schedule of fees to be paid by or on behalf of each participant in the program, and may, from time to time, modify same. Such + See morefees shall defray the ongoing expenses of the program. Provided, however, that pursuant to an agreement with the department a municipality, department thereof, or other agency may conduct a course in such program with all or part of the expense of such course and program being borne by such municipality, department or agency. In no event shall such fee be refundable, either for reasons of the participant's withdrawal or expulsion from such program or otherwise.
|
Cost of program
|
All | Yes | Department of Motor Vehicles | Delegation to commissioner of motor vehicles |

New York | N.Y. Veh. & Traf. Law § 503 | Termination of License Revocation Fee |
An applicant whose driver's license has been revoked pursuant to (i) section five hundred ten of this title, (ii) section eleven hundred ninety-three of this chapter, and (iii) section eleven hundred ninety-four of this chapter, shall, + See moreupon application for issuance of a driver's license, pay to the commissioner a fee of one hundred dollars. When the basis for the revocation is a finding of driving after having consumed alcohol pursuant to the provisions of section eleven hundred ninety-two-a of this chapter, the fee to be paid to the commissioner shall be one hundred dollars.
|
$100.00 - $100.00 | All | Yes | Department of Motor Vehicles | N/A |

New York | N.Y. Veh. & Traf. Law § 503 | Termination of Driving Privileges Revocation Fee (Non-resident) |
(i) A non-resident whose driving privileges have been revoked pursuant to sections five hundred ten, eleven hundred ninety-three and eleven hundred ninety-four of this chapter shall, upon application for reinstatement of such driving privileges, + See morepay to the commissioner of motor vehicles a fee of twenty-five dollars. Such fee is not refundable and shall not be returned to the applicant regardless of the action the commissioner may take on such person's application for reinstatement of such driving privileges.
|
$25.00 - $25.00 | All | Yes | Department of Motor Vehicles | N/A |

New York | N.Y. Veh. & Traf. Law § 1199 | Driver Responsibility Assessment |
In addition to any fines, fees, penalties and surcharges authorized by law, any person convicted of a violation of any subdivision of section eleven hundred ninety-two of this article, or any person + See morefound to have refused a chemical test in accordance with section eleven hundred ninety-four of this article not arising out of the same incident as a conviction for a violation of any of the provisions of section eleven hundred ninety-two of this article, shall become liable to the department for payment of a driver responsibility assessment as provided in this section.
|
$750
$250 per year for three years |
All | Yes | Department of Motor Vehicles | N/A |

New York | N.Y. Veh. & Traf. Law § 1196 | Fee for Conditional License following Alcohol or Drug Rehabilitation |
(d) The commissioner shall require applicants for a conditional license to pay a fee of seventy-five dollars for processing costs. Such fees assessed under this subdivision shall be paid to + See morethe commissioner for deposit to the general fund and shall be in addition to any fees established by the commissioner pursuant to subdivision six of this section to defray the costs of the alcohol and drug rehabilitation program.
|
$75.00 - $75.00 | All | Yes | Department of Motor Vehicles | N/A |
